Kimono Dress: A Universal Fashion Choice

Kimono dresses and robes transcend beachwear; they symbolize style, cultural heritage, and sustainability. What sets the kimono apart is its unparalleled universality.

The traditional Japanese long dress, once tied to complex rituals and ceremonies, has undergone a remarkable transformation. It has adapted to modern tastes, offering a blend of cultural exchange and contemporary chic.

Gone are the days when kimonos were reserved solely for sunny days by the sea. Today, a kimono dress, flattering to every figure, can be worn as a flowing beach robe, a belted dress for evening outings, or paired with a t-shirt and jeans for everyday wear.

Different fabrics, colors, and patterns can make each kimono a favorite wardrobe piece. Moreover, the rise of sustainable and ethical fashion has further boosted the popularity of kimonos. Various eco-friendly materials (like linen and silk) and ethical production practices make the kimono fit into the values of conscientious consumers who seek style without sacrificing principles. As a timeless piece that withstands the test of time, the kimono invites us to adopt a more conscious approach to sustainable fashion.
